Presbyterian Bean Soup

Here's how you make Presbyterian Bean Soup

  • Servings: 8
  • Prep: 1d
  • Cook: 4h
  • The following recipe serves 8 people.

Ingredients

The ingredients are:
  • Soak
  • 3 tablespoons pinto beans, dry
  • 3 tablespoons navy beans, dry
  • 3 tablespoons kidney beans, dry
  • 3 tablespoons black eye peas, dry
  • 3 tablespoons split peas, dry
  • 3 tablespoons lentils, dry
  • 3 tablespoons barley, dry
  • 3 tablespoons large lima beans, dry
  • 3 tablespoons baby lima beans, dry
  • 2 tablespoons salt
  • 8 cups water
  • Ham
  • 1 pound ham hock
  • 8 cups water
  • Soup
  • 1 cup onion, diced
  • 28 ounces tomatoes (1 can)
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/2 teaspoon pepper
  • 1/2 teaspoon chili powder
  • 1 teaspoon lemon juice
  • 1 teaspoon sugar

How to Make

  • Step 1: Wash beans, place in large kettle.

  • Step 2: Cover with water, 2 inches.

  • Step 3: Add 2 tablespoons salt.

  • Step 4: Soak overnight.

  • Step 5: Drain in morning.

  • Step 6: Add 2 quarts of water and ham hocks or ham bone. Bring to boil.

  • Step 7: Simmer slowly for 3 hours.

  • Step 8: Add 1 large chopped onion and 1 large can of tomatoes (or 1 quart home-canned tomatoes). Season with 1/2 to 1 teaspoon chili powder, 1 teaspoon lemon juice, 1 teaspoon sugar and 1/2 teaspoon pepper and salt.

  • Step 9: Remove ham hock, leave any ham.

  • Step 10: Simmer slowly for 1 hour or more.
